Transaction 83e2cee709fb29e239605813823aa7df357b850006e1faac4ed20029de6a984e
1 Input
1 Output
-
83e2cee709fb29e239605813823aa7df357b850006e1faac4ed20029de6a984e:0
- value
- 103679705
- script pubkey
- OP_0 OP_PUSHBYTES_20 85d0c19669be478a7d98c1d33e65bae21f4c3318
- address
- bc1qshgvr9nfherc5lvcc8fnued6ug05cvcc9qhcjz